NYC Radio: WPLJ Hosts The Band Perry, Clean Bandit

The Band Perry
WPLJ 95.5 FM in New York continues the momentum and excitement that Cumulus Media-New York's new live performance space is generating for music lovers.

The live performance space, tagged "Stage 17 LIVE", is high atop Madison Square Garden on the 17th Floor of 2 Penn Plaza. On March 1, Luke Bryan made an inaugural appearance at the new performance space while visiting sister station NASH FM 94.7 and the performances have now moved into high gear! On Tuesday, March 7, The Band Perry performed in the space for 95.5 PLJ listeners, as did Clean Bandit and Anne Marie. 95.5 loyal listeners were treated to tacos for Taco Tuesday, while enjoying great performances by these exciting artists in a true VIP, experiential setting.

Chad Lopez, Vice President/Market Manager, Cumulus Media-New York said: “The momentum is building with interest from various artists for the new Cumulus New York performance space. 95.5 PLJ welcomed two great bands to the 17th floor on the same day during our soft launch of the new studio. This is the first of many VIP experiential opportunities that we will have to offer to our advertisers and listeners and we couldn’t be more excited."

Gillette, 95.5 PLJ Program Director, said: "The Band Perry's new song may be titled “Stay in the Dark”, but they totally lit up Stage 17 LIVE for the very first full-band performance in our new “house”! Now the Perry family is forever immortalized  as part of the 95.5 P(erry)LJ family!"
